I have been in the Pocono Mountains for a few days now and have enjoyed quite a few restaurants, but started craving some authentic Puerto Rican food a day or two ago.....and let me tell you....I'm so happy I found this restaurant on google! Team members were on point with their menu knowledge, recommendations, and friendliness! Liz and Ivanna made us feel like we were visiting family! Chefs know exactly how Puerto Rican food should taste and the food we ordered did not disappoint one bit. Perfect balance of flavor and that home cooked feel! Ricardo the chef throws down in the kitchen for sure! A perfect venue for family style eating with a clean and beautifully Puertorican style decorated dining area - made us feel like we were on the island. Salsa music playing in the background at the perfect volume added to the dining experience. We had some fritters to start with (alcapurrias, sorrullitos, and rellenos de papa), Bistec Salteado (steak cooked to perfection smothered in bell peppers and onions), the roasted pork, with arroz con gandules (rice with pigeon peas) and a salad as the main course. The house dressing for the salad was perfect, too. For dessert, we ordered some flan and a tres leches slice of cake (to-go). The pastry chef knows what they are doing! So good! If you want pasteles on the spot you can get them on weekends, but they are sold frozen to take home and cook any day. Definitely recommend El Rincon Caribe and will for sure be back soon. This place does not disappoint! Free parking available.

Walking into El Rincon Caribe in Tannersville, Pennsylvania, you get the sense that this is a spot focused on the food more than the frills. I went for takeout and ordered the stew chicken along with a mofongo, and while I was not impressed by how either dish looked when I opened the containers, both ended up being packed with flavor. The stew chicken was tender with a deep, savory sauce that paired perfectly with the rice. The mofongo had just the right amount of garlic and seasoning, with a good balance of texture that kept it from being too dry. Their menu is full of homestyle comfort food like pulled pork, pepper steak, pork ribs, and even oxtail if you want to splurge, with most meals priced between ten and eighteen dollars depending on the size. For the quality and portion sizes, the prices felt fair, especially considering how well-seasoned the food was. What holds the experience back a little is not the food, but everything around it. The customer service was not bad, but I would rate it closer to three out of five. The staff got the job done, but there was not a lot of warmth or personality in the interaction, which makes a difference when you are deciding whether to come back. The inside of the restaurant is clean and functional but not memorable, and the parking is average, so it is convenient enough for a quick pickup. Despite that, the food itself makes El Rincon Caribe worth checking out if you want hearty, flavorful Puerto Rican and Caribbean dishes without paying too much. The flavor and portion sizes make it a solid choice for takeout, even if the service and atmosphere do not stand out.
